A quick story of being told off. (which I’m very glad about)
I was in a room with Nigel Botterill on Tuesday.
He’s been my mentor since 2014, and has had a profound effect on me, my mindset and my business.
I was giving an update on what had happened since our last meeting in January.
And I quickly dived into everything EXCEPT our key numbers.
So he probed a bit further.
I started talking about our lead flow into one part of the business and that it wasn’t hitting target.
He asked me how much I was spending on ads. (It had been part of the plan back in January)
And with maximum cringe I said ‘nothing’.

"Emma, I believed you when you told me the plan in January - so why aren't you doing the things?"
We’re Nigels actual words.
In the following 30 minutes I probably used the word ‘procrastinate’ 10 times.
Have you ever been in a situation where the one thing you need to do is the actual thing you’re not doing?
That was me sat in front of Nigel.

A very apt reminder every time you walk into Nigels boardroom 🥲
Underneath it all I realised it came down to one thing: I didn’t feel like I knew what I was doing
and when you don't know what you're doing, your brain tries to protect you - from feeling foolish, not good enough, from failing.
That’s its job.
The science tells us that every time you procrastinate you strengthen the neural pathways in your brain which favour avoidance to protect you from the emotion you might feel when you make the decision.
You’re literally wiring yourself to procrastinate even more.
That's exactly what I was doing.
Strengthening the wrong pathway, every single week I didn’t start.
And sometimes we all just need that little ‘push’ from someone to say, "Emma, just do the thing."
So before you close this email what's your thing?
The one you've been circling.
The one that someone believed you were going to do.
Making the wrong decision is better than no decision - at least you're learning each time. With no decision you're just stagnant.
This week, do one small part of it.
Not all of it.
Just one hour a day.
Thats exactly what I’ll be doing.
Implementing, learning and refining paid ads.
The thing I’ve been avoiding since January.

Ai Tool of the Week 🤖
Long term Win the Week fans will remember Ai Tool of the week and it is back and here to stay 🎉
This week I want to tell you about Wispr Flow https://wisprflow.ai/
A voice to text AI tool that has genuinely changed how fast I write. You speak, it types - but the clever bit is it polishes as it goes. No robotic transcription. Just clean, accurate writing appearing in whatever app you're already working in.
No integrations. No faff. It just works.
I've been using it on my laptop and phone and it's made my writing so much faster.
